Welcome to the darkside. That looks a little rough to me, but the listing has a phone # to call for further info, and there might be someone up there in the Fresno area to check that car out for you. As a general rule, anything worthy of consideration for purchasing is worth checking out in person.
In addition to what ever the owner is referring to as a dozen things, with most of them being collectable items by now, you can new passenger side headlight buckets, (might be an indication of collosion), new bumper fillers before long, new bumper rub strips, which are no longer available for the GN, I don't think, and I notice that he shows a nice front to rear driver side shot to indicate the straightness of the body, but I did not see one for the passenger side, or my computer the pic did not open up. I would want to see some good close up shots of the t-top frames without the t-tops on the car to determine structural integrity in that area. Many a new t-top owner wishes to hell that he did not buy a t-top when he removes the panels. Watertrap area for sure. Just my opinion, and I am known to be very opinionated. Probably worth a call, but I would not get my hopes up.

the we4 is pretty much a black turbo regal with the black out package, the interior is all grey unlike the gn witch is two tone. i personaly like the t-types since you can get them in any color, the gns look mean and all but how many gns and gn clone do you see on the road? and how many clean t-type do you see...not that many.with the we4 you can slap on some gn badges and redue the interior and your pretty some set. welcome to the socal section we got some pretty fast cars and lots of knowledge here....enjoy;)
